Proper Handling and Storage
To maintain product integrity:
- Store in a cool, dry place away from direct sunlight
- Keep container tightly sealed when not in use
- Use in well-ventilated areas or under fume hoods
- Avoid contact with oxidizing agents
- Follow standard lab safety protocols for flammable liquids

Common Questions About 2-Pentanol
New users often wonder about its properties and uses. This secondary alcohol has a characteristic odor and boils at around 119°C. Its moderate polarity makes it useful for dissolving both polar and non-polar compounds. Unlike primary alcohols, it undergoes different oxidation pathways, which can be advantageous in specific synthesis routes.

How does 2-pentanol differ from other pentanol isomers?
2-Pentanol has the hydroxyl group on the second carbon, giving it different physical properties and reactivity compared to 1-pentanol or 3-pentanol. This positioning affects its use in specific synthesis pathways.
